A bit more about the founders:

Alexandra is the founder and CEO of Harvester.City. Harvester is a two-sided crowd-sharing platform for members of the urban agriculture community. Organized by user profiles, Harvester allows business and individuals the ability to connect and collaborate through the sharing of ideas, knowledge, resources, and data from different functions within the supply chain.

Before Harvester Alex working and volunteering in the Urban Agriculture space. Beginning with designing and exploring the feasibility around 3D printed aquaponic indoor growing units for both consumer and post-aid disaster relief. She had first hand experienced the difficulties and challenges facing the industry leading her to the desire to create Harvester.City. When she is not wearing her plant pioneer hat, she is working freelance for a variety of food + tech startups looking to disrupt their industry.

Alessio is the founder & CEO at ForwardFooding, the world’s first collaborative platform for the food and beverage industry. In 2014, he founded Crowdfooding with the aim of broadening access to capital for food and FoodTech entrepreneurs and ever since started to build a community of innovators tackling some of biggest challenges affecting our food system.

With Forward Fooding he now works with companies of all sizes with their endeavours of understanding how entrepreneurship, collaboration, and investment models can be used to create a more sustainable future of food. Alessio regularly speaks and consults food company on technology and investment models to foster food innovation. A global citizen at heart he has lived and worked in Italy, South Korea, Australia, US and UK where he is currently based.
